So we had some significant oral arguments of the Supreme Court over whether or not Trump

0:42.4

can fire Lisa Cook, who is on the Fed Board of Governors. We can put actually this tear

0:47.7

sheet up on the screen, which explains some of the backstory here. So it says the Supreme

0:51.3

Court appears likely to allow Lisa Cook to remain on the Fed

0:56.5

board. The Supreme Court on Wednesday appeared likely to block President Trump from immediately

1:00.6

firing Democratic-appointed Lisa Cook from the Federal Reserve Board, a move that would prevent

1:05.2

Trump from exerting greater influence over the powerful central bank that guides the economy.

1:09.7

Nearly all of the justices ask skeptical

1:12.7

questions of Solicitor General D. John Sauer during roughly two hours of arguments taking issue
